CHEERLEADERS
The Cheerleading squads consist of spirit oriented students at both the varsity and junior varsity levels. Cheerleaders lead the crowds in supporting our athletic teams and help cheer on our teams during pep rallies. The girls also provide publicity for games and are expected to participate in service projects. Attendance at practice is mandatory for both squads.
Meetings: Two-three practices a week and a mandatory cheer camp in the summer.
Qualifications: GPA of 2.0, successful tryout.
Enrollment Deadline: Open to rising freshmen, sophomores, juniors and seniors enrolled in BK at tryout time. Tryouts are held in the spring.

KENNY ANGELS
Kenny Angels is a service organization composed of girls who run the concession stands for the Athletic Department. Participation fulfills service hour requirements.
Meetings: Monthly, August-February
Qualifications: Girls must be in 10th, 11th, or 12th grade and must apply by April 30th.
Enrollment Deadline: April 30
Leadership Opportunities: Seniors are elected as officers.
LETTERMEN'S CLUB
A service organization that provides a means for unity and brotherhood among the athletes of BK.
Meetings: Monthly.
Qualifications: Each member must have received a letter in a varsity sport. Each proposed member must be recommended by the coach of his respective sport and must attend the induction ceremony.
Enrollment Deadline: October 10
Leadership Opportunities: President, Vice-President, Secretary, Treasurer, Sergeant of Arms
RED AND WHITE GIRLS
The Red and White Girls are a support group for the BK baseball teams. Duties include selling season tickets, working in the concession stand and ticket booth, raising money, keeping statistics and the score book, working the scoreboard and announcing the games.
Meetings: Three times a year
Qualifications: Any interested female in grades 9-12 with a minimum GPA of 2.0.
Enrollment Deadline: The end of November.
